2010 Elantra with Steering Wheel Vibration
I have a 2010 Hyundai Elantra Blue with man trans, and I have a significant vibration in my steering wheel when cruising at above 50mph. It will put my hands to sleep after about 1/2 hour of driving. I had tires/wheels force balanced - but no change. Funny thing is that, when I'm cruising and I push in the clutch and coast - the vibration goes away. That makes me think it coming from somewhere in the power delivery system upstream of the clutch. Dealer says there's no problem - but I have a 2010 Elantra GLS with auto trans and it doesn't have this vibration. Whatcha think?
